Importance of Audio in Gaming
Audio plays a critical role in gaming, significantly influencing player immersion and engagement. High-quality sound enhances the overall experience, allowing players to connect emotionally with the game. Tbis connection is vital for maintaining interest and prolonging gameplay. Sound cues can also provide essential information, guiding players through challenges.
Moreover, immersive audio can create a sense of presence in virtual environments. It transforms gameplay into a more realistic experience. Players often report feeling more involved when sound is prioritized. This is not just a preference; it’s a necessity. Effective audio design can differentiate a game in a crowded market. Innovative Sound Processing Techniques
DigiEar employs innovative sound processing techniques to enhance audio quality in gaming. He utilizes dynamic range compression to balance sound levels effectively. This technique ensures that quieter sounds are audible while preventing distortion from louder sounds. Additionally, he implements equalization to tailor audio frequencies to specific gaming environments. This customization improves clarity and detail in sound reproduction.
Furthermore, he incorporates convolution reverb to simulate realistic acoustic spaces. This method creates an immersive auditory experience. The use of adaptive audio algorithms allows for real-time adjustments based on gameplay dynamics. Such responsiveness is crucial for maintaining player engagement.
